Benzyl(diphenyl)silicon

Base Information
  • Chemical Name:Benzyl(diphenyl)silicon
  • CAS No.:18676-90-9
  • Molecular Formula:C19H18 Si
  • Molecular Weight:273.4238
  • Hs Code.:
  • NSC Number:155360
  • DSSTox Substance ID:DTXSID30422630
  • Wikidata:Q82234592
